    Now this is a question from a white ago. I feel okay helping. We never want to jump in. Always allow the poster time to respond. So his is our run down on the shower:

    Basketweave floor the floor and can be cut in half for the trim. This can be found online here in honed or here is just the largest collection of marble basketweave that can ship in 1-2 Business Days and is under $15.00.

    They have capped it with a trim either an "ogee rail or a chair rail. We have both. Here is the chair rail.

    Honed Italian Chair Rail. But could be Ogee.

    Then Basketweave is cut to create a border or you could skip that and use a pre-cut border which saves a lot of time and money. That are on here: http://www.thebuilderdepot.com/borders.html 

    Then finally a 3x6" Ceramic Subway Tile on this page. But given this is over a year old 4x12" has actually replaced 3x6" for the Subway size of choice. I would go for that instead in the Ceramic. A great choice with white grout. Or go for a glass tile. Both equally non-porous and will hold up well for decades.

    Don't forget to seal that shower floor every so often!
